There is no scientific evidence that sesame oil can cure allergic rhinitis. Allergic rhinitis can be treated with antihistamines and other drugs under the advice of a doctor. Fragrance oil, as a food, does not have the effect of medication, so it cannot cure allergic rhinitis. The main symptoms of allergic rhinitis include runny nose, sneezing, etc. Most of the nasal mucus is mainly clear watery mucus, and the nose will be strangely itchy. Commonly used therapeutic drugs include antihistamines, glucocorticoids, leukotriene antagonists and decongestants. Antihistamines, common drugs include chlorpheniramine, loratadine and so on. The main function of antihistamines is to fight against allergies, and common adverse reactions include poor concentration, drowsiness, etc. Patients who are allergic to the ingredients contained in antihistamines need to use them with caution.
